+DOCUMENTATION = '''
+---
+module: rabbitmq_binding
+author: "Manuel Sousa (@manuel-sousa)"
+version_added: "2.0"
+
+short_description: This module manages rabbitMQ bindings
+description:
+ - This module uses rabbitMQ Rest API to create/delete bindings
+requirements: [ "requests >= 1.0.0" ]
+options:
+ state:
+ description:
+ - Whether the exchange should be present or absent
+ - Only present implemented atm
+ choices: [ "present", "absent" ]
+ required: false
+ default: present
+ name:
+ description:
+ - source exchange to create binding on
+ required: true
+ aliases: [ "src", "source" ]
+ login_user:
+ description:
+ - rabbitMQ user for connection
+ required: false
+ default: guest
+ login_password:
+ description:
+ - rabbitMQ password for connection
+ required: false
+ default: false
+ login_host:
+ description:
+ - rabbitMQ host for connection
+ required: false
+ default: localhost
+ login_port:
+ description:
+ - rabbitMQ management api port
+ required: false
+ default: 15672
+ vhost:
+ description:
+ - rabbitMQ virtual host
+ - default vhost is /
+ required: false
+ default: "/"
+ destination:
+ description:
+ - destination exchange or queue for the binding
+ required: true
+ aliases: [ "dst", "dest" ]
+ destination_type:
+ description:
+ - Either queue or exchange
+ required: true
+ choices: [ "queue", "exchange" ]
+ aliases: [ "type", "dest_type" ]
+ routing_key:
+ description:
+ - routing key for the binding
+ - default is #
+ required: false
+ default: "#"
+ arguments:
+ description:
+ - extra arguments for exchange. If defined this argument is a key/value dictionary
+ required: false
+ default: {}
+'''
+
+EXAMPLES = '''
+# Bind myQueue to directExchange with routing key info
+- rabbitmq_binding: name=directExchange destination=myQueue type=queue routing_key=info
+
+# Bind directExchange to topicExchange with routing key *.info
+- rabbitmq_binding: name=topicExchange destination=topicExchange type=exchange routing_key="*.info"
+'''

+import requests
+import urllib
+import json
+
+def main():
+ module = AnsibleModule(
+ argument_spec = dict(
+ state = dict(default='present', choices=['present', 'absent'], type='str'),
+ name = dict(required=True, aliases=[ "src", "source" ], type='str'),
+ login_user = dict(default='guest', type='str'),
+ login_password = dict(default='guest', type='str', no_log=True),
+ login_host = dict(default='localhost', type='str'),
+ login_port = dict(default='15672', type='str'),
+ vhost = dict(default='/', type='str'),
+ destination = dict(required=True, aliases=[ "dst", "dest"], type='str'),
+ destination_type = dict(required=True, aliases=[ "type", "dest_type"], choices=[ "queue", "exchange" ],type='str'),
+ routing_key = dict(default='#', type='str'),
+ arguments = dict(default=dict(), type='dict')
+ ),
+ supports_check_mode = True
+ )
+
+ if module.params['destination_type'] == "queue":
+ dest_type="q"
+ else:
+ dest_type="e"
+
+ if module.params['routing_key'] == "":
+ props = "~"
+ else:
+ props = urllib.quote(module.params['routing_key'],'')
+
+ url = "http://%s:%s/api/bindings/%s/e/%s/%s/%s/%s" % (
+ module.params['login_host'],
+ module.params['login_port'],
+ urllib.quote(module.params['vhost'],''),
+ urllib.quote(module.params['name'],''),
+ dest_type,
+ urllib.quote(module.params['destination'],''),
+ props
+ )
+
+ # Check if exchange already exists
+ r = requests.get( url, auth=(module.params['login_user'],module.params['login_password']))
+
+ if r.status_code==200:
+ binding_exists = True
+ response = r.json()
+ elif r.status_code==404:
+ binding_exists = False
+ response = r.text
+ else:
+ module.fail_json(
+ msg = "Invalid response from RESTAPI when trying to check if exchange exists",
+ details = r.text
+ )
+
+ if module.params['state']=='present':
+ change_required = not binding_exists
+ else:
+ change_required = binding_exists
+
+ # Exit if check_mode
+ if module.check_mode:
+ module.exit_json(
+ changed= change_required,
+ name = module.params['name'],
+ details = response,
+ arguments = module.params['arguments']
+ )
+
+ # Do changes
+ if change_required:
+ if module.params['state'] == 'present':
+ url = "http://%s:%s/api/bindings/%s/e/%s/%s/%s" % (
+ module.params['login_host'],
+ module.params['login_port'],
+ urllib.quote(module.params['vhost'],''),
+ urllib.quote(module.params['name'],''),
+ dest_type,
+ urllib.quote(module.params['destination'],'')
+ )
+
+ r = requests.post(
+ url,
+ auth = (module.params['login_user'],module.params['login_password']),
+ headers = { "content-type": "application/json"},
+ data = json.dumps({
+ "routing_key": module.params['routing_key'],
+ "arguments": module.params['arguments']
+ })
+ )
+ elif module.params['state'] == 'absent':
+ r = requests.delete( url, auth = (module.params['login_user'],module.params['login_password']))
+
+ if r.status_code == 204 or r.status_code == 201:
+ module.exit_json(
+ changed = True,
+ name = module.params['name'],
+ destination = module.params['destination']
+ )
+ else:
+ module.fail_json(
+ msg = "Error creating exchange",
+ status = r.status_code,
+ details = r.text
+ )
+
+ else:
+ module.exit_json(
+ changed = False,
+ name = module.params['name']
+ )
+
+# import module snippets
+from ansible.module_utils.basic import *
+main()
